随着移动互联网的迅猛发展,越来越多的用户倾向于使用数字钱包进行交易,IM云钱包就是其中之一。IM云钱包不仅提供安全、便捷的支付方式,同时也为开发者提供了将其钱包系统对接至移动应用程序的解决方案。在这篇文章中,我们将详细讨论如何将IM云钱包成功对接到您的APP中,帮助开发者充分利用这一支付工具,为用户提供更好的服务。
IM云钱包的概述
IM云钱包是一种集成支付工具,允许用户使用多种支付方式快速、便捷地完成交易。它为用户提供了一个集中管理个人资金的平台,支持包括银行卡、信用卡、电子货币等多种支付方式。IM云钱包的安全性和高效性使其成为了开发者在构建应用程序时的重要选择。
IM云钱包对接的必要性
对于开发者而言,将IM云钱包集成到应用程序中,可以为用户提供更好的支付体验,提升用户的满意度和忠诚度。通过集成IM云钱包,用户可以快速完成交易、查看交易历史,还能够享受一些奖励和优惠,这些都是增加用户粘性的有效手段。同时,随着用户对数字支付要求的提高,完善的支付系统有助于吸引更多用户下载和使用你的APP。
IM云钱包对接流程
要将IM云钱包对接到您的APP中,您需要进行以下几个步骤:
1. 注册IM云钱包开发者账号
在对接之前,您需要先在IM云钱包官方网站注册一个开发者账号。注册完成后,您将获得开发者密钥和必要的API文档,这些都是对接过程中需要用到的基础资料。
2. 加入SDK
IM云钱包通常会提供SDK(软件开发工具包),帮助开发者更好地集成其支付系统。您需要下载SDK并将其集成到您的应用项目中。如果您的APP是Android或iOS平台,确保您下载相应版本的SDK。
3. 配置基本信息
在SDK版本集成完成后,您需要在项目中对IM云钱包进行基本配置,包括API密钥、商户ID等信息。这些信息通常会在注册开发者账号时获得,确保配置无误以避免后续对接失败。
4. 编写支付逻辑
在对接完成基本信息后,接下来要编写APP的支付逻辑。根据IM云钱包API文档的说明,调用相应的接口进行支付请求。这一步是整个对接的关键,必须确保逻辑正确,以免造成用户支付失败或数据丢失。
5. 测试支付功能
在完成支付逻辑的编写后,您需要进行测试。IM云钱包通常会提供测试环境,允许开发者在没有真实资金交易的情况下进行功能测试。测试完成之后,确保支付功能流畅无误,再进行正式发布。
6. 上线和维护
当所有的测试都通过后,您可以将包含IM云钱包的APP发布到应用市场。在上线后,定期检查对接的稳定性和安全性,必要时及时更新SDK版本,以确保用户的支付安全。
可能相关的问题
1. IM云钱包的安全性如何保障?
安全性是支付系统的重要考量因素。IM云钱包采用了多重安全防护措施,例如SSL加密技术、双重身份验证等,以确保用户的交易信息和账户数据的安全。通过SSL加密,用户的数据在传输过程中能够有效防止被窃取或篡改。此外,IM云钱包还允许用户设置复杂的密码及启用手机验证码,进一步提升账户的安全性。开发者在集成IM云钱包时,也要遵循相关安全标准,例如不在代码中硬编码密钥,避免信息泄露。
2. 如何处理支付失败的情况?
支付失败的情况有多种可能原因,包括网络连接问题、用户账户余额不足、支付接口故障等。在开发过程中,您需要在APP中设计合理的错误处理机制。首先,应该在支付请求时提供友好的提示信息,引导用户排查问题。例如,如果余额不足,提示用户充值或选择其他支付方式。其次,开发者可以在应用中记录所有支付请求和返回的状态,便于后续调试和问题排查。确保用户能够方便地联系客服支持,及时获取技术帮助,能够有效提升用户的体验。
3. IM云钱包对接需要支付多少费用?
IM云钱包通常会根据交易量或交易金额收取一定的手续费。具体的费用标准可以通过IM云钱包官方网站或开发者文档进行查询。在对接之前,开发者应仔细了解这些费用,以便做出合理的营收预期。如果对接的是真币支付,可能还需要考虑到汇率和提现手续费等细节。建议在项目预算中留出支付手续费的部分,以确保项目的盈利性。同时,开发者应合理设计收费标准,以平衡用户体验和公司盈利。
4. IM云钱包的用户注册流程如何设计?
在对接IM云钱包之后,用户的注册流程至关重要。一套简单易操作的注册流程能够大幅提升用户的使用体验。首先,建议针对新用户提供一键注册的功能,例如使用手机号、邮箱或第三方账户(如微信、QQ)的快捷登录方式。其次,注册时须收集的基本信息应控制在最低限度,避免用户因填写繁琐的注册信息而放弃注册。此外,为确保账户安全,注册时最好提供邮箱验证码或手机验证码的验证环节。开发者还可以引入用户协议和隐私政策的勾选,保证用户在注册过程中的信息安全和合法性。
5. 如何提高IM云钱包的用户使用率?
提升用户使用IM云钱包的频率,可以从多个维度入手。首先是用户体验,保证支付流程的简便和流畅,减少用户在支付过程中的等待时间和步骤。可以通过提供优惠活动、返利等方式来吸引用户主动选择使用IM云钱包进行支付。其次,在APP中适时推送与用户消费习惯相关的提示或活动,增加用户对IM云钱包的关注。此外,用户的反馈和评价至关重要,收集用户意见并做出相应改进,可以有效提升用户的满意度,让更多用户主动选择IM云钱包。
总之,将IM云钱包对接到您的APP中是一个重要且细致的过程,涉及注册、SDK集成、支付逻辑编写及测试等多个步骤。这不仅仅是技术问题,更多的是对用户体验的关注,合理处理可能出现的问题,提高用户使用率才是对接成功的关键。
